Sony took the opportunity at IFA, in front of an extremely packed press conference, to state its ambitions to take over the (TV) world by 2010.And it thinks it has four new machines that could help it achieve global domination.
The EX-1 is the world’s first LCD Picture Frame TV with integrated high-definition wireless connectivity.
For the EX-1 design, Sony looked to the humble photo frame and has made a TV that mirrors simple frames so does not look out of place mounted on a wall.
And because it has integrated wireless tech - any unsightly cables are unnecessary, and devices, such as Blu-ray players, can be kept away from the TV - which has a wireless range of 30m for streaming HD 1080p images.
